Output 51c95d28b0edb12338bb80f216577cfc1bd3a3de45ba1240f7ea1dfd0e9d8368: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1a402ca34389d586dc3325e31ba57d22f91e337 OP_EQUALVERIFY OP_CHECKSIG
address
1HCH5dbWknEDXUs2LD6tAxT6YCSpVSDRc8
transaction
51c95d28b0edb12338bb80f216577cfc1bd3a3de45ba1240f7ea1dfd0e9d8368
spent
true